2025-07-03media: v4l2: Add Renesas Camera Receiver Unit pixel formatsDaniel Scally
The Renesas Camera Receiver Unit in the RZ/V2H SoC can output RAW data captured from an image sensor without conversion to an RGB/YUV format. In that case the data are packed into 64-bit blocks, with a variable amount of padding in the most significant bits depending on the bitdepth of the data. Add new V4L2 pixel format codes for the new formats, along with documentation to describe them.
